Meet Santa in Leicestershire

November 10th 2025

Nothing captures the magic of Christmas quite like a visit to Santa’s Grotto. Across Leicestershire, there are plenty of enchanting spots to treat your little ones. From beautiful garden centres to dining experiences, animal adventures and much more, here’s your run-down of some of the best ways to meet Father Christmas (or Santa Paws) this festive season.

The Great Central Railway Santa Express

Take a seat on a traditional heritage steam train travelling through the Leicestershire countryside and to the Leicester North Pole (or Loughborough, as it’s known by locals!) You will be joined by not only Santa, but Mrs Claus and the GCR elves, who will spread the magic through singing, storytelling and activities of all kinds for the kids. Grown-ups will also have their own treat of Irish Cream Liqueur and a toasty mince pie to enjoy while you relax and soak up the joy and laughter of the children. SEND-friendly Santa’s Grotto at Amy’s House

Amy’s House is bringing a special SEND-friendly Grotto to Burbage on 14 December, ensuring festive joy for every child this season. Designed for children with additional needs, the grotto offers a calm, caring, and inclusive space where families can enjoy meeting Santa in a relaxed setting. More information here.

Buttercups Tearoom

Buttercups Tearoom in Billesdon is transforming into the sparkling North Pole this Christmas, inviting families to enjoy a truly magical festive experience. Little ones can embark on an arctic trail, spotting friendly polar animals before meeting Santa in his grotto. Each child receives a special gift, and families can capture all the magic with a photo- the perfect keepsake. Every weekend from 6 to 21 December, between 10am and 3pm Get your tickets now.

Dinner with Santa at Tithe Barn

Visit Santa at Tithe Barn for an extra special treat, where you can indulge in a delicious breakfast or lunch with Santa. Every Saturday or Sunday from 6 December, each child will leave with a souvenir photo and a gift (and a £5 voucher for the adults to come back) all for only £15. If you have a four-legged furry child, don’t miss the Santa Paws event on Sunday 30 November and treat your dog to a wholesome, unique experience in support of Leicester Animal Aid. Christmas Capers South Wigston

On 6th December, a wholesome local community event provides the festive atmosphere and entertainment in different locations within the Borough of Oadby and Wigston. You will find the classic Santa’s grotto in Elliott Hall amongst endless craft and gift stalls, surrounded by street entertainment, live music and steaming food to top of your visit to Santa. Don’t miss the light switch on at 5:30pm to brighten up the evening. Find more information here.
